: Since my last posting I have made some progress with this card under Linux. 
: Under the guidance of the Sierra folks the card works with the standard serial 
: driver using the cis flag. This points to a separate binary file that 
: overrides the card probe and explicitly tells the machine what the card CIS 
: info is. Any suggestions on how to do this under freebsd? Alternatively, any 
: suggestions on how to extract the relevant info from the cis file to make the 
: freebsd driver work. Here's the output from 'cardctl config' under linux:

Right now there's no mechanism to do this easily.  With OLDCARD,
there's no way.  With NEWCARD there's a hint mechanism for the CIS,
but I've not used it in a long time.  Look at
src/sys/dev/pccard/pccard.c

We really need to have something like this.
